Almazbek Atambayev: When special forces went up to third floor, I shot

«Only I had weapons when the guys — special forces — went to the third floor, I shot five or six times up,» the former president of Kyrgyzstan Almazbek Atambayev told reporters.

He added that it was dark. «I don’t know whether it was bound shot or not, I tried not to hit any of the guys (special forces — Note of 24.kg news agency), but someone kept pushing them forward all the time, I immediately warned that I would resist. I openly say that in order none of the guys (Atambayev’s supporters — Note of 24.kg news agency) to be accused of it,» the former president said.

Almazbek Atambayev also told that all the weapons were on the third floor in his house. «The people gave us everything, we don’t give arms to anyone,» he said.

Yesterday night, special forces of the SCNS attempted to detain the former president of the country Almazbek Atambayev in Koi-Tash village. However, the storm failed. Atambayev’s supporters did not let the special forces into the house of the former head of state. During the second detention attempt, riots broke out. Nearly 50 people were taken to hospitals in Bishkek and Chui region. One serviceman of the SCNS Special Forces received a gunshot wound. He died in a hospital. The head of the Main Internal Affairs Department of Chui region was broken his head. He’s in a coma. Criminal cases were opened after riots in Koi-Tash.
